The source critiques the current state of the Marvel Cinematic Universe (MCU), noting that Phases 4 and 5 have suffered from narrative overload, inconsistent quality, and declining box office returns since the successful conclusion of the Infinity Saga with Avengers: Endgame. The episode argues that the solution to reinvigorating the franchise lies in leveraging the legacy of Iron Man/Tony Stark, the character who originally anchored the MCU both emotionally and commercially. Various pathways for revival are explored, including the return of actor Robert Downey Jr. as the villain Doctor Doom, focusing on legacy characters like Ironheart and War Machine, and utilizing multiverse variants to restore a sense of centralized, character-driven storytelling that is currently missing from the franchise.
